1. Understanding Cat Doors
Cat doors been available in different designs, ranging from easy flap doors to electronic designs that only allow signed up animals to pass through. The kind of cat door picked substantially affects both the total cost and installation trouble.
Types of Cat Doors:
TypeDescriptionTypical Cost (GBP)Traditional Flap DoorBasic installation, typically made from plastic or wood.₤ 20 - ₤ 50Magnetic Flap DoorFunctions magnets to keep the flap close.₤ 25 - ₤ 75Electronic Cat DoorUses a microchip or a crucial fob to permit gain access to.₤ 150 - ₤ 500Wall-Mounted DoorInstalled through a wall rather than a door.₤ 100 - ₤ 3002. Elements Influencing Installation Costs
A number of factors add to the installation prices of cat doors, including:
-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ors, like electronic designs, generally need more detailed installation.
- Installation Site: Installing a door on a strong wood door usually costs less than installing one on a wall.
- Home Design: Older or uniquely designed homes may introduce extra obstacles for installation, resulting in increased costs.
- Labor Costs: Geographic area and need in your location will impact the per hour rates of installers.
- Additional Features: Features such as security locks or weather sealing will add to the general cost.
3. Typical Costs of Cat Door Installation
The table below shows the average costs associated with working with a professional to set up a cat door.
Service IncludedTypical Cost (GBP)Basic Installation (Flap Door)₤ 100 - ₤ 200Complex Installation (Wall, Electronic)₤ 200 - ₤ 500Additional Custom Features₤ 25 - ₤ 50 per functionRemoval of Existing Door₤ 50 - ₤ 150Cost of Materials₤ 20 - ₤ 1004. The Price Breakdown of Cat Door Installation
A comprehensive price breakdown can assist prospective pet owners understand what to expect regarding cat door installation expenses.
Preliminary Consultation: A consultation charge frequently varies from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50, depending upon whether you require the service to encourage on door choice or installation technique.
Products: The typical cost of materials can differ, especially if you have particular choices (like vinyl, wood, or custom-made functions). Anticipate to pay in between Repair My Windows And Doors and ₤ 100 for products.
Labor Costs: The per hour labor rate for experts can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 80, depending upon the complexity of the installation and your geographical area.
Various Add-Ons: If you require extra functions, such as weather removing or customized framing, the expenses can add ₤ 25 to ₤ 50 per improvement.

6. FAQs
Q1: Can I set up a cat door myself to save money?A1: Yes, many pet owners choose to set up cat doors as a DIY task. Nevertheless, bear in mind that this needs some general handyman abilities, and improper installation might result in problems down the roadway. Q2: Are there any specific licenses required for installing a cat door?A2: Generally, many homes do not require licenses for cat door installation, however it's important to inspect local building guidelines, particularly for wall installations. Q3: How do I select the right size for my cat door?A3: Measure your cat's height and width to guarantee that the door you pick will accommodate their size easily, typically allowing a couple of extra inches for ease of gain access to.
